How much do entry level mern stack develop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level mern stack developer in Waco, TX is $52.61,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43.75 and $60.62 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an Entry Level Mern Stack Developer job?

An Entry Level MERN Stack Developer is a beginner-level software developer who works with the MERN stack, which includes MongoDB, Express.js, React, and Node.js. Their responsibilities typically include developing and maintaining web applications, working with databases, writing frontend and backend code, and debugging issues. They collaborate with senior developers, designers, and other team members to build scalable applications. Employers usually expect basic knowledge of JavaScript, RESTful APIs, and version control systems like Git. This role is ideal for recent graduates or self-taught individuals looking to start a career in full-stack web development.

What types of projects or tasks can I expect to work on as an Entry Level MERN Stack Developer?

As an Entry Level MERN Stack Developer, you will typically work on building and maintaining web applications by developing both server-side and client-side features. You'll collaborate with experienced developers to design APIs, integrate user interfaces, debug code, and manage databases. Your day-to-day tasks may include writing reusable code, participating in code reviews, and troubleshooting technical issues. Working within agile teams, you'll also learn best practices for software development and have opportunities to contribute to real-world products, helping you build valuable skills for future growth.
